So if you don’t know, Mickey’s Not-So-Scary Halloween party is the Halloween event that they do in Magic Kingdom; they run it from Mid-August to the beginning of November. I had the absolute pleasure of going in 2023 for my friend Bella’s birthday, and I knew that I wanted to go again this year.
